Floodwaters recede in Western Division

Floodwaters in the Western Division, including Nadi and Rakiraki have receded, however, evacuation centres remain open.

Restrictions on movement in Nadi Town has also been lifted.

This has been confirmed by the Western Division Command Centre.

They say rain has stopped and water level in flood prone areas of Utelei Settlement, Korovuto, Nawaka and Nadi Bus Stand have receded.

Nadi Back Road, Namotomoto end and Temple end is also accessible to all traffic.

In Rakiraki Nadonumai Crossing, Namonamo Road, Tova Crossing, Mataso Tova Road, Gallau Road, and FSC Road are also open now.

Nadi businessman Mohammed Khan says floodwaters have caused some damage to some shops.

While speaking to fijivillage News, Khan says there was about three feet of water on the town's main street.

He adds that the flash flooding caught some business owners off guard, which left them unable to prepare properly.

Khan says some shops have unfortunately sustained damage, but the full extent will only be known after proper assessment.
